I came out to try one of Austin’s newest BBQ truck: The Flaming Pit and y’all… They may just be a top 3 contender in town for best BBQ.
I got to try a couple of their items such as:
- The Big Baby: this beauty is made up of sliced brisket, mac & cheese, and jalapeño and was phenomenal. The meat was so damn tender that you barely had to chew it. ($17)
- The CC: this is their 3 meat plate with 3 sides and a dessert. I got their brisket, sausage, and spare ribs. Pork ribs are usually my fav, but the sausage here was the clear winner. It was PACKED with flavor and if you squeeze it, you can see all the juices come out. ($27)
- Mac & Cheese: they take gruyere and extra sharp white cheddar cheese, mix it with the macaroni, add parmesan & bread crumb topping to give you some of the best mac & cheese that I’ve gotten from a BBQ spot. I’m not a fan when it’s all creamy and cheesy, so this was amazing to me. It reminded me as if I was eating fancy mac & cheese from a steakhouse and that’s the idea and why they use higher quality ingredients! (Included)
- Mexican Street Corn: their take on this classic side dish was more on the spice side of things and not as creamy and rich as I expected. If I had to give a suggestion it would be to add a bit more of that creamy aspect that the classic dish usually has, but it was still good nonetheless! (Included)
- Banana Pudding: this tastes as great as you’d expect. A balanced, refreshing way to end the meal! (Included)
- Big Squeeze Lemonade: so damn good!! It’s made fresh every day with lemon, simple syrup, and sugar and was some of the best I’ve had in town. I had to get a 2nd! ($2.50)
All in all, I believe they stand amongst the ATX greats such as Valentina’s and Terry Black’s.
Prices may look a bit high, but for high quality BBQ it’s fair – especially with food prices up right now and them being in a food truck. I also love the ambiance they have going on. It’s a great place to come hang out with friends! The area is developing as they plan to add an outside bar, 2 more food trucks, and some games. In conclusion, I highly suggest y’all come try them out! I rate them a 5/5!
